Section 1: Understanding Equity Crowdfunding Pitch Deck Importance

1.1 Equity Crowdfunding Overview:
Equity crowdfunding is a fundraising model that allows entrepreneurs to sell shares or equity stakes in their company to a diverse group of individual investors through online platforms. This innovative approach democratizes the investment landscape, providing opportunities for retail investors to participate in early-stage investments.

1.2 Defining the Pitch Deck:
An equity crowdfunding pitch deck is a visually engaging and succinct presentation that entrepreneurs use to convey their business idea and potential to potential investors. It serves as a persuasive tool to spark investor interest, build credibility, and secure funding. Calling it a pitch book is equally acceptable as the terms are often used interchangeably.

Section 3: Structure of the Equity Crowdfunding Pitch Deck

3.1 Cover Slide:
The cover slide is the first impression of the pitch deck and should include the company’s name, logo, and a visually engaging image that represents the business’s essence.

3.2 Problem and Solution:
Clearly articulate the problem the business seeks to solve and how its products or services address this issue. This section demonstrates the company’s value proposition and its potential impact on the market. Detail the company’s offerings, explaining their features, benefits, and how they address customer needs. Include any patents, trademarks, or intellectual property that provide a competitive advantage. This one section in any equity crowdfunding pitch book could support everything else in the offering. 3.3 Market Opportunity:
Provide data-driven insights on the size of the target market, trends, and growth projections. Investors want to understand the addressable market and the potential for scalability.

3.4 Market Analysis
Investors want to understand the market opportunity and potential for growth. In this section, entrepreneurs should present market research, industry trends, and competitive analysis to demonstrate their understanding of the market landscape.

3.5 Competitive Analysis:
Identify key competitors and showcase the company’s advantages and differentiation. Highlight any unique features or intellectual property that give the business a competitive edge.

3.7 Go-to-Market Strategy:
Explain how the company plans to acquire customers and grow its user base. This section should demonstrate a clear and actionable marketing plan.

3.7 Financial Projections:
Present realistic and data-supported financial projections, including revenue forecasts, expenses, and profitability. This section is crucial in demonstrating the company’s financial viability and growth potential.

3.8 Business Model:
Outline the company’s revenue model, pricing strategy, and distribution channels. This section should emphasize how the business plans to generate revenue and achieve profitability.

3.9 Use of Funds:
Clearly define how the funds raised through equity crowdfunding will be utilized to achieve specific milestones and fuel the company’s growth.

3.10 Executive Summary
The executive summary is a concise overview of the business’ leadership, highlighting related experience in the space, prior track record and, if deemed valuable enough, educational background. Section 4: Crafting an Effective Equity Crowdfunding Pitch Deck

4.1 Simplicity and Clarity:
Keep the pitch deck concise and avoid jargon. Use simple language and visuals to ensure that potential investors can easily understand the company’s value proposition.

4.2 Storytelling and Engagement:
Craft a compelling narrative that weaves together the company’s journey, vision, and milestones. Engaging storytelling helps investors connect emotionally with the business.

4.3 Visual Appeal:
Investors receive numerous pitch decks, making visual appeal critical. Use eye-catching graphics, images, and charts to make the presentation visually engaging and memorable.

4.4 Call-to-Action:
End the pitch deck with a clear call-to-action, inviting potential investors to take the next steps, whether it’s scheduling a meeting or expressing interest in the investment opportunity.

4.5 Clear Value Proposition
An effective pitch book should articulate the company’s unique value proposition and what sets it apart from competitors. This statement should resonate with potential investors and create excitement about the business’s potential. Skip hyperbole and the usual “puffing” found in a sales pitch lest you incur the wrath of the SEC.

4.6 Credibility and Traction
Entrepreneurs should showcase any significant achievements, milestones, or customer testimonials that demonstrate market traction and validate the business’s potential for success.

4.7 Transparent Risk Assessment
Address potential risks and challenges that the business may face. Investors appreciate transparency and want to know that entrepreneurs have considered and are prepared to mitigate potential pitfalls.

Section 6: Compliance and Regulatory Considerations

6.1 Regulatory Compliance
Equity crowdfunding operates under specific regulations depending on the country or region. Entrepreneurs must ensure their pitch book complies with relevant securities laws and disclosure requirements.

6.2 Due Diligence
Investors should conduct thorough due diligence before committing their funds to an equity crowdfunding campaign. A comprehensive pitch book helps investors evaluate the opportunity more effectively.
